Domande di colloquio [1]
Domanda 1
scss or tailwind css
sort array of objects by doj
sort array of numbers with top being divisible by 3 and then rest in descending order in Vue js editor
vue 2 vs vue 3
use strict meaning and how it works with hoisting
let const and var
performance optimization
hooks in vue
why there was need of vue 3

Technical The Snowflake interview process typically involves several stages designed to evaluate both technical and problem-solving skills:
1. Initial Screening:
A phone or video interview with HR to discuss your background, experience, and interest in the role.
2. Technical Assessment:
A coding or SQL test to assess your proficiency in writing optimized queries, handling data pipelines, and working with Snowflake features.
3. Technical Interviews:
Multiple rounds focused on:
Snowflake Architecture: Deep understanding of how Snowflake handles storage, compute, and queries.
SQL Skills: Writing complex queries and optimizing performance.
Data Modeling: Designing schemas relevant to real-world scenarios.
ETL Processes: Using Snowflake integrations like Snowpipe and tasks.
4. Behavioral/Managerial Rounds:
Assess cultural fit, communication skills, and how you approach challenges in teamwork or projects.
5. Final Round:
Sometimes includes a case study or presentation to demonstrate your understanding of Snowflake's ecosystem.
